New Zealand Business Visitor Visa 3 A Smart Move for Global Professionals A streamlined pathway for international business travellers to engage in short-term commercial activities whilst visiting New Zealand for up to three months within a 12-month period. Perfect for professionals seeking to conduct negotiations, attend conferences, or participate in trade missions without the complexity of a full work visa.

Permitted Business Activities Allowed Activities: Attending business meetings, conferences and seminars Negotiating and signing contracts or trade agreements Conducting market research and business consultations Participating in trade fairs (promotional purposes only) Attending professional development and training sessions
Restrictions: No paid work or employment in New Zealand Cannot establish a business presence No provision of consulting services for fee
Application Requirements and Documentation Core Documentation Valid passport (minimum 3 months beyond intended departure) Recent passport-sized photographs Completed visa application

Visa Duration and Entry Conditions Duration Parameters
1
Stay allowed up to 3 months (90 days) within any 12month period. This is strictly enforced and overstaying can affect future visa applications.

Activity Restrictions No paid work permitted under any circumstances. Short-term study (up to 3 months) is allowed if relevant to business purpose.
